#1ad04c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1ad04c is composed of 10.2% red, 81.6% green and 29.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 63.5% yellow and 18.4% black. It has a hue angle of 136.5 degrees, a saturation of 77.8% and a lightness of 45.9%. #1ad04c color hex could be obtained by blending #34ff98 with #00a100. Closest websafe color is: #33cc33.

Shades and Tints of #1ad04c

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#021006 is the darkest color, while #fefffe is the lightest one.
